Westhouse (French pronunciation: [vɛstuz]; German: Westhausen) is a commune in the Bas-Rhin department in Alsace in north-eastern France.[3]

Population
| Year | Pop. | ±% p.a. | 
|---|---|---|
| 1968 | 941 | — | 
| 1975 | 922 | −0.29% | 
| 1982 | 953 | +0.47% | 
| 1990 | 1,170 | +2.60% | 
| 1999 | 1,351 | +1.61% | 
| 2007 | 1,416 | +0.59% | 
| 2012 | 1,441 | +0.35% | 
| 2017 | 1,515 | +1.01% | 
| Source: INSEE[4] | ||
